Upon completion, you’ll be emailed an ATT (Authorization To Test), including your exam location.Apr 29, 2022 · Licensed EMTs typically complete an EMT course similar to the 14-day , which encompasses 120+ hours of training in order to become certified. On the other hand, a paramedic builds on their initial EMT foundation by completing a full 1,200+ hours of training before certification. This higher level of training can take one to two years to complete. If you're interested in being a paramedic, …EMT-Basic (EMT-B) EMT-Intermediate (EMT-I) EMT-Paramedic (EMT-P) Paramedics are the highest level of EMT and receive the most training. The NREMT requires 120-150 hours of training to become an EMT-Basic, which can take up to six months to complete. This is much shorter than the required 1,200-1,800 hours, often one two years of training ...Pathways to becoming a paramedic. Some flight paramedic jobs have more competitive salary and benefits packages than others.Mar 3, 2023 · In some states, a high school diploma or GED is the only educational requirement for paramedic certification. In other states, administrators may require candidates to have a two-year emergency medical services (EMS) degree or a four-year college degree. A lot of states don't have specific subject requirements for college degrees.
